Sodium Chlorite Bleaching Stabilizer

Use:Stabilizer for bleaching with sodium chlorite.
Appearance: Colorless and transparent liquid.
Ionicity: Nonionic
pH Value: 6
Water solubility: Completely soluble
Hard water stability: Very stable at 20°DH
Stability to pH: Stable between pH 2-14
Compatibility: Good compatibility with any ionic products, such as wetting agents and fluorescent brighteners
Foaming property: No foam
Storage stability
Store at normal room temperature for 4 months, Place near 0℃ for a long time will cause partial crystallization, resulting in difficulties in sampling.

Properties
The functions of Stabilizer for bleaching with sodium chlorite Can be summarized as follows:
 This product controls the bleaching action of chlorine so that chlorine dioxide produced during bleaching is fully applied to the bleaching process and prevents any possible diffusion of toxic and corrosive odorous gases (ClO2);Therefore, the use of Stabilizer for bleaching with sodium chlorite can reduce the dosage of sodium chlorite;
 Prevents corrosion of stainless-steel equipment even at very low pH.
To keep the acidic pH stable in the bleaching bath.
Activate bleaching solution to avoid the generation of side reaction products.

Solution preparation
Even with automatic feeder being used, Stabilizer 01 is easy to make feeding operation.
Stabilizer 01 is diluted with water in any ratio.

Dosage
Stabilizer 01 is firstly added and subsequently adds the required dosage of acid to working bath.
The usual dosage is as follows:
 For one part of 22% sodium chlorite.
 Use 0.3-0.4 parts of Stabilizer 01.
 The specific use of concentration, temperature and pH should be adjusted according to the changes of fiber and bath ratio.
 During bleaching, when additional sodium chlorite and acid are needed, Stabilizer 01 is not necessary to be appended accordingly
